Automatic vs Manual: What’s the Difference When It Comes to Car Hire?

One of the first choices you’ll need to make around car hire is whether to go for a manual or an automatic vehicle. While both options have their pros and cons, they offer very different driving experiences, and your choice can affect everything from fuel consumption to hire costs.

If you’re unsure which type of rental car suits you best, this guide breaks down the key differences between manual and automatic vehicles and what to consider before booking.

What’s the Difference Between Automatic and Manual Cars?

In a manual car, you change gears yourself using a clutch pedal and gearstick. With automatics, the vehicle shifts gears for you, so there’s no clutch and no gear changes to worry about.

This simple mechanical difference can have a big impact on how the vehicle drives, and which option is best for your journey.

Benefits of Hiring a Manual Car

  • Lower hire cost – In the UK, manual car hire is often cheaper than hiring an automatic, simply because there are more manual vehicles available.
  • More control – Some drivers prefer the hands-on feel of driving a manual car, especially on hilly or rural routes.
  • Wider availability – Manual cars are still the norm in the UK, so you’re likely to find more choice when booking.

Benefits of Hiring an Automatic Car

  • Easier to drive – Automatics are ideal for city driving or long journeys, removing the need to constantly shift gears in traffic.
  • Better for beginners or international drivers – If you’re not familiar with UK roads or not confident driving a manual, automatics can feel more relaxed.
  • Smoother experience – Especially in newer models, automatics offer a smooth, stress-free drive, particularly in stop-start conditions.

Manual and Automatic Car Hire Cost Difference

In general, automatic car rental tends to be slightly more expensive than manual. That’s because automatics are often newer models, and there are fewer of them in UK car hire fleets.

If you’re flexible on your choice, manual cars may offer better value. But for those prioritising convenience, comfort, or who only have an automatic licence, the higher price can be worth it.

Fuel Consumption: Does It Differ?

Fuel economy used to be one of the main reasons drivers opted for manual cars. However, many modern automatic vehicles are now just as efficient, especially with the introduction of hybrid and electric models.

That said, if you’re hiring an older car or prioritising cost per mile, a manual may still offer better fuel economy in some cases.
